MUARA, BRUNEI-MUARA
The Seafood Carnival, organised by the Department of Fisheries, Ministry of Primary Resources and Tourism, will end its run at 5pm today at the Muara Fish Landing Complex. The four-day carnival served as a platform to sell fresh fish to the public.
Different species of fish are being sold at the carnival along with processed seafood products.
According to an officer from the Fisheries Department, the event is well received and is attracting huge crowds.
The hightlight of the carnival is the sale of fish, prawn, crab and squid. Other products that are being sold include sea bass, pompano, grouper and red snapper.
Meanwhile, processed seafood products that are being sold include fish crackers, 'belacan' (shrimp paste), salted and dried fish and smoked fish, to name a few.
The event aims to assist local vendors to promote and sell their products. Fish products at the event are being sold at reasonable prices.
